NASA's new Wide Field Camera 3 has been built for installation during HST Servicing Mission 4. Equipped with state-of-the-art detectors and optics, WFC3 will provide wide-field imaging with continuous spectral coverage from the ultraviolet into the infrared, dramatically increasing both the survey power and the panchromatic science capabilities of HST.

Below, we show the relative discovery efficiencies of the current HST cameras and WFC3. Here, the discovery efficiency is proportional to the total system throughput at the pivot wavelength of the broadband filters and proportional to the field of view.
